laravel php不是内部或外部命令,未找到Laravel PHP命令

回答(16)

laravel php不是内部或外部命令,未找到Laravel PHP命令_第1张图片

2 years ago

如果您已全局安装Composer,则可以使用以下命令安装Laravel安装程序工具:

composer global require "laravel/installer=~1.1"

laravel php不是内部或外部命令,未找到Laravel PHP命令_第2张图片

2 years ago

使用Mac

对于zsh:

echo 'export PATH="$HOME/.composer/vendor/bin:$PATH"' >> ~/.zshrc

source ~/.zshrc

对于Bash:

echo 'export PATH="$HOME/.composer/vendor/bin:$PATH"' >> ~/.bashrc

source ~/.bashrc

laravel php不是内部或外部命令,未找到Laravel PHP命令_第3张图片

2 years ago

type on terminal:

nano ~/.bash_profile

then paste:

export PATH="/Users/yourusername/.composer/vendor/bin:$PATH"

then save (press ctrl+c, press Y, press enter)

now you are ready to use "laravel" on your terminal

laravel php不是内部或外部命令,未找到Laravel PHP命令_第4张图片

2 years ago

将以下内容添加到 .bashrc 文件(不是 .bash_profile ) .

export PATH="~/.composer/vendor/bin:$PATH"

在文件的末尾,然后在终端

source ~/.bashrc

验证:

echo $PATH (重启终端,检查确认路径是否存在)

运行laravel命令!

laravel php不是内部或外部命令,未找到Laravel PHP命令_第5张图片

2 years ago

如果您使用的是Ubuntu 16.04 .

你需要找到我的情况下的作曲家配置文件:

~/.config/composer 或在其他情况下 ~/.composer/

你可以在这个命令后看到dir

composer global require "laravel/installer"

Laravel安装后

你可以在 ~/.config/composer/vendor/laravel/installer/ 找到你的laravel .

你会在这里找到Laravel快捷命令:

~/.config/composer/vendor/bin/

使用 nano ~/.bashrc 设置.bashrc并导出您的composer配置文件:

export PATH="$PATH:$HOME/.config/composer/vendor/bin"

或者你可以使用别名 . 但建议采用上述解决方案 .

alias laravel='~/.config/composer/vendor/laravel/installer/laravel'

现在使用 source ~/.bashrc 刷新你的bashrc然后laravel准备就绪!

以上步骤适用于Ubuntu 16.04

laravel php不是内部或外部命令,未找到Laravel PHP命令_第6张图片

2 years ago

Type on terminal:

composer global require "laravel/installer"

When composer finish, type:

vi ~/.bashrc

Paste and save:

export PATH="~/.config/composer/vendor/bin:$PATH"

Type on terminal:

source ~/.bashrc

打开另一个终端窗口并输入:laravel

laravel php不是内部或外部命令,未找到Laravel PHP命令_第7张图片

2 years ago

我设置了PATH,但它没有用 . 我找到了解决它的其他方法 . (OSX 10.10 & laravel 5.2)

1)找到可执行文件:

~/.composer/vendor/laravel/installer/laravel

2)给予执行权限:

chmod +x ~/.composer/vendor/laravel/installer/laravel

3) Build 一个软链接 /usr/bin:

sudo ln -s /Users/zhao/.composer/vendor/laravel/installer/laravel /usr/bin/laravel

laravel php不是内部或外部命令,未找到Laravel PHP命令_第8张图片

2 years ago

对于zsh和bash:

export PATH="$HOME/.config/composer/vendor/bin:$PATH"

source ~/.zshrc

source ~/.bashrc

仅限bash:

export PATH=~/.config/composer/vendor/bin:$PATH

source ~/.bashrc

laravel php不是内部或外部命令,未找到Laravel PHP命令_第9张图片

2 years ago

当我进入我的〜/ .bashrc文件中添加导出PATH =“$ HOME / .composer / vendor / bin:$ PATH”时,vim向我表明它是一个新文件 . 我为.zshrc文件做了同样的尝试,vim说它也是新的 . 我继续将它添加到新创建的〜/ .bashrc文件中并重试运行laravel并找不到-bash:laravel命令 .

我想我要么将该行粘贴到错误的.bashrc文件中 . 我找不到我应该粘贴它的文件 .

laravel php不是内部或外部命令,未找到Laravel PHP命令_第10张图片

2 years ago

在终端

# download installer

composer global require "laravel/installer=~1.1"

#setting up path

export PATH="~/.composer/vendor/bin:$PATH"

# check laravel command

laravel

# download installer

composer global require "laravel/installer=~1.1"

nano ~/.bashrc

#add

alias laravel='~/.composer/vendor/bin/laravel'

source ~/.bashrc

laravel

# going to html dir to create project there

cd /var/www/html/

# install project in blog dir.

laravel new blog

laravel php不是内部或外部命令,未找到Laravel PHP命令_第11张图片

2 years ago

对于开发人员,请使用 zsh 将以下内容添加到 .zshrc 文件中

vi ~/.zshrc 或 nano ~/.zshrc

export PATH="$HOME/.composer/vendor/bin:$PATH"

在文件的末尾 .

zsh 不知道 ~ 所以改为使用 $HOME .

source ~/.zshrc

完成!尝试命令 laravel 你会看到 .

laravel php不是内部或外部命令,未找到Laravel PHP命令_第12张图片

2 years ago

对于那些使用Linux和Zsh的人:

1 - Add this line to your .zshrc file

export PATH="$HOME/.config/composer/vendor/bin:$PATH"

2 - Run

source ~/.zshrc

composer文件夹的Linux路径与Mac不同

在Zsh的路径中使用 $HOME 而不是 ~

.zshrc 文件隐藏在主文件夹中

export PATH= 以引号导出路径,以便系统可以找到Laravel可执行文件

:$ PATH是为了避免覆盖系统路径中已有的内容

laravel php不是内部或外部命令,未找到Laravel PHP命令_第13张图片

2 years ago

对于 MAC 用户:

1. 打开终端

cd ~

2. 仔细检查$ PATH

echo $PATH

3. 编辑文件

nano ~/.bash_profile

4. 粘贴

export PATH="~/.composer/vendor/bin:$PATH"

Don't forget 加上引号 .

5. 控制X(y输入保存文件并退出)

现在开始流浪汉,转到你的文件夹并尝试:

laravel new yourprojectname

laravel php不是内部或外部命令,未找到Laravel PHP命令_第14张图片

2 years ago

好的,我做到了,它的工作原理:

nano ~/.bash_profile

并粘贴

export PATH=~/.composer/vendor/bin:$PATH

重启终端享受;)

Important :如果你想知道bash_profile和bashrc之间的区别请检查link

Note: 对于运行laravel 5.1的Ubuntu 16.04,路径为:〜/ .config / composer / vendor / bin

laravel php不是内部或外部命令,未找到Laravel PHP命令_第15张图片

2 years ago

如果在mac上(想想* nix),只需在你的终端上运行它 .

export PATH="~/.composer/vendor/bin:$PATH"

laravel php不是内部或外部命令,未找到Laravel PHP命令_第16张图片

2 years ago

1)首先,使用Composer下载Laravel安装程序:

composer global require "laravel/installer"

2)确保将 ~/.composer/vendor/bin directory 放在PATH中,以便系统可以找到laravel可执行文件 .

set PATH=%PATH%;%USERPROFILE%\AppData\Roaming\Composer\vendor\bin

eg: “C:\Users\\AppData\Roaming\Composer\vendor\bin”

3)安装完成后,简单的laravel new命令将在您指定的目录中创建一个全新的Laravel安装 .

eG: laravel new blog

你可能感兴趣的:(laravel,php不是内部或外部命令)